The Flushmate M-101526-F3BK is a premium pressure-assist toilet tank replacement designed for 500-series Flushmate toilets. Engineered in the USA, it delivers a powerful 1.6 GPF flush with a sleek wire-operated handle, complete with all necessary installation components. Nice upgrade. Not hard to install and well-worth the price.
Replaced the 25-year old, trusty Flushmate tank (it leaked and did not hold pressure overnight anymore) with this newer model. Pic1 is the old tank, pic 2 the newly installed tank, same location. Only difference between the models (far as install is concerned) is the flush handle (included in the package). This is now via a wire, instead of a direct steel rod linkage. Remember that the flush handle screw is a left-hand thread (I always forget this little fact). The new tank has a more powerful flush and for the last 2 months after install works like a charm. Would purchase again, but hope won't have to for another 25 years.

Great power assist tank, but directions are somewhat confusing.
Flushmate M-101526-F3BK Sloan Flushmate 501-B Tank. An excellent replacement and updated tank. Very well made. I originally ordered an incorrect tank due to "Fuzzy" info in the title description. FYI: the incorrect tank was the "Flushmate M-101526-F31 III 503" which I didn't understand by the description & other provided info was for a top lid, push button flushing unit. This unit the "Flushmate M-101526-F3BK Sloan Flushmate 501-B Tank" is the one I needed which is for an either left or right side or front mounted flushing handle. This unit came with a new flush handle & attached mechanism (different from the original one on the 30+ year old toilet that I worked on.) as well as the 3 in one tool. Was all very nice. I found the instructions to be somewhat confusing and believe that the average person would agree. Adjusting the cartridge is very important and necessary for the unit to work correctly. Took me longer than necessary to install due to the somewhat confusing directions, but all ended well. You will not regret buying this unit if you are wanting to maintain the POWER FLUSH that it provides. It can not be installed into a unit that didn't originally come with this inserted tank.

What a snap to change out.
Replaced old unit with this new one. The old unit had a crack in the seam and not pressurizing. It took less than a hour to un-install old unit and reinstall with new one. Photo 1 new unit in, photo 2 old unit in shipping box. If I had to say anything negative it would be the new unit did not come with new tank bolts and rubber washer, those are fail points due to age. You may want to purchase those at your local before stating the job. I also had a deep well socket, 1/2" that made the job of removing the tank much faster. The tool that's included helps as well with install of new unit. I reused my original flush arm, it is a rod that seems more durable than the one in the box. All in all the toilet is working as good as new. Also the old unit was 10 years old, I hope to get that out of this one.
